The Kingsburg Joint Union High School District Board of Trustees held public hearings June 10 on the district’s 2026–27 Local Control Accountability Plan (LCAP) and on the proposed 2026–27 budget.
Assistant Superintendent of Student Services Heather Wilson provided copies of the full 2026–27 LCAP and the 2026–27 LCFF Budget Overview for Parents and opened the floor for public comment. Assistant Superintendent of Business Services Rufino Ucelo Jr. delivered the budget summary overview and outlined the district’s fiscal assumptions for LCFF funding and planned expenditures for the coming year.
No formal vote was required during the hearings; materials were entered into the record and will guide upcoming budget and plan adoption processes. The presentations signaled priorities for the coming year, including student services and instructional programs referenced in the LCAP materials.
